How to Make Million Dollar Yum Yum Chicken Casserole
This recipe is super easy to make with only a few simple ingredients. Spray a 9×13-inch baking dish with nonstick cooking spray. Spread chopped cooked chicken in the bottom of the pan and set aside. In a medium bowl, stir together cream of chicken soup, cottage cheese, sour cream, and cream cheese. Season with onion powder, garlic powder, salt, and pepper. Spread soup mixture over the chicken layer. Sprinkle a box of stuffing mix over the top of the casserole. Pour chicken broth and melted butter over the stuffing mix. Bake in a preheated oven until bubbly.
Helpful Tips & Frequently Asked Questions
- I use rotisserie chicken for the cooked chicken in this dish.
- You can use any cooked chicken you have on hand. Chicken breasts, chicken thighs, chicken tenderloins, or canned chicken all work great.
- Can substitute cooked turkey.
- You can use any flavor of condensed cream of soup in this casserole. Cream of Chicken, Cream of Mushroom Soup, and Cream of Celery all work great.
- Look for Unsalted Cream of Chicken to reduce the sodium.
- Here is our recipe for Homemade Cream of Chicken Soup: https://www.plainchicken.com/homemade-cream-of-chicken-soup/
- I use cornbread flavored Stove Top Stuffing. You can use any flavor you enjoy.
- Do NOT make the stuffing. You are only using the dry mix.
- Feel free to add vegetables to the casserole.
- broccoli
- spinach
- frozen mixed vegetables
- Can I make Chicken & Stuffing Casserole in advance? Yes! Assemble the casserole. Cover the pan with plastic wrap and place in the refrigerator until ready to bake.
- You may need to add 10 to 15 minutes to the cooking time if you are baking the casserole straight from the refrigerator.
- Can I freeze Chicken & Stuffing Casserole? Yes! Assemble the casserole and cover the dish with plastic wrap and aluminum foil. Place in the freezer for up to 3 months.
- When ready to eat, thaw and bake as directed.
- Store the leftover chicken casserole in an airtight container in the fridge.

Yum Yum Million Dollar Chicken Casserole
Equipment:
Ingredients:
- 5 cups chopped cooked chicken
- ⅓ cup sour cream
- 2 -oz cream cheese, room temperature
- ¾ cup cottage cheese
- 2 (10.5-oz) can cream of chicken soup
- ½ tsp onion powder or to taste
- ¼ tsp garlic powder or to taste
- 1 (6-oz) box cornbread stuffing, uncooked
- ¾ cup chicken broth
- 4 Tbsp melted butter
Instructions:
- Preheat oven to 350ºF. Lightly spray a 9×13-inch pan with cooking spray.
- Spread chicken in the bottom of the dish. In a separate bowl, mix together the cream of chicken soup, sour cream, cream cheese, cottage cheese, onion powder, and garlic powder. Spread over the chicken.
- Sprinkle the uncooked stuffing over the soup mixture. Mix together the broth and the melted butter and pour evenly over the stuffing.
- Bake, uncovered, for 30 minutes.
